The present invention provides a welding device for welding workpieces (9) made of high-temperature resistant super alloys. The device comprises: a heat source (3) for creating a heat application zone (11) on the workpiece surface (10); a feed mechanism (5) for feeding welding filler material (13) into the heat application zone; and a conveying device (15) for creating a relative movement between the heat source (3) and the feed mechanism (5) on one hand and the workpiece surface (10) on the other hand. The welding device also comprises a controller (17) having a control program that performs the relative movement in such a way that the welding power and the diameter of the heat application zone (11) are set such that the cooling rate at the time of solidification of the material is at least 8000 Kelvin per second.
